#4d725f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d725f is composed of 30.2% red, 44.7%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 149.2 degrees, a saturation of 19.4% and a lightness of 37.5%. #4d725f color hex could be obtained by blending #9ae4be with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#4d725f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060907 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d725f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c635f is the less saturated color, while #04bb5d is the most saturated one.
